Well I've had a bit of a diaster nail art wise over the past few days!!
I ordered lots of bits from the Hong Kong website posted up earlier in the thread (am lazy and cannot remember the name - sorry!). I got some nail wraps and I was very excited to try them out, however the pattern I chose didn't look as if it would work as my nails weren't long enough, and I was right so instead of pink and gold the wraps were just gold which looked really garish! And they didn't fit on right as the instructions didn't really match the wraps!
So I ended up putting one nail on and then took it off and painted instead. I went with one of my many untrieds. It looked yellow in the bottle but turned out to look like a mustard colour. Or like what one of my colleagues said yesterday, nicotine stained! So some modification was required.
In my order from HK I ordered a stamper and a plate to try out. I didn't buy any special polish, but chose one of my own. Put the polish on the plate, scraped with the scraper (obv!) but the scraper just took ALL of the polish away and didn't leave any in the pattern AT ALL!!! Not sure if I was doing it wrong or whether it was the tools I'd purhased...........
I tried with another polish and that didn't work either. So in the end I used another of my untrieds, a barry M blue crackle. However I am getting bored of crackle polish and really want to try some other stuff.
So all in all so far I'm really disappointed, as I was so excited to come in with pretty nails today and I've failed. *sob*
Might have to buy a proper konad set when I get paid next week.0 -
